Try this;
In The Memoirs of Earl Warren (1977), Warren wrote:
“I was deeply reluctant… I told the President I did not wish to serve.”
“The President then told me that the nation was in grave danger of a war we might not survive… that foreign governments were already spreading the belief that the assassination was the result of a conspiracy.”
He said Johnson emphasized that:
“If the people of the world believed this, it could lead to war.”
“I was persuaded that if I refused, there might be a war which could cost 40 million lives.”
There you have it.

Here’s your fun. Been there done that.
CE399 has a clear chain of possession -- From Tomlinson, to Wright, to
Johnsen, to Rowley, to Todd, to Frazier.
A prosecutor (such as my favorite lawyer/author Vincent Bugliosi), at the
trial (had there been one), would have simply called the above- referenced
individuals to the witness stand in order to establish the "chain" (which
certainly would have been established without a shred of a doubt).
Mr. Bugliosi, at the Oswald "TV Docu-Trial" in 1986 (which did adhere to
REAL rules of evidence and court procedures, even though it wasn't an
actual trial), in fact did (in essence) establish the admissibility of
Stretcher Bullet CE399 in a courtroom setting, which occurred during the
questioning of witness Vincent Guinn, when Bugliosi listed the official
pieces of evidence that Dr. Guinn examined for the HSCA, including CE399
and one of the two large bullet fragments found in the front seat of the
limousine.
